Drift Wood is a versatile and widely used natural wood hardscape for freshwater aquariums and aquascaping projects. With its organic form, twisted branches, and textured surfaces, drift wood helps recreate natural riverbank and forest environments inside the aquarium.
It is perfect for attaching aquatic plants such as mosses, Anubias, Java fern, Bucephalandra, and Bolbitis, allowing aquascapers to create mature, nature-style layouts. Drift wood also provides hiding spots, breeding areas, and territories for shrimp, plecos, and other fish species.
Like most natural woods, drift wood may release tannins initially, slightly tinting the water and helping replicate natural blackwater conditions. It also supports beneficial bacteria growth, contributing to a stable and healthy aquarium ecosystem.
